High premium convertible debenture

A bond with a long-term, high-premium, common stock conversion feature. It also offers a competitive interest rate. This type of investment vehicle is aimed at bond investors who want to be able to convert into stock to hedge against inflation.

Convertible bond

Convertible bond

General debt obligation of a corporation that can be exchanged for a set number of common shares of the issuing corporation at a prestated conversion price.

Convertible Arbitrage

Convertible Arbitrage

In the context of hedge funds, a style of management that involves the simultaneous purchase of a convertible bond and the short sale of shares of the underlying stock. Interest rate risk may or may not be hedged.
